Avantages

=> Very high trust environment. For instance, no "expense report authorizations" required. Just do what you think is right and don't abuse it => Not cut-throat, collegial => Successful company with good product portfolio

Inconvénients

=> surprisingly old (lots more "30 year tech veterans from Amdol" than 5 year out of school kids) => Rampant title disparity, some corporate staff roles do zero work (and earn Senior Director or VP titles) while line jobs (eng, prod mgmt, sales mainly) are carrying a huge load for Manager or Director title. Sounds petty, but it's really frustrating to the line => Surprising amount of red tape in the product development orgs - we're talking 16 months to get a feature included in a new release, and getting slower! Simply not nimble
